About Kaanapali Land, LLC

Kaanapali Land, LLC engages in the property and agriculture businesses in the state of Hawaii. The company's Agriculture segment is involved in farming, harvesting, and milling operations relating to coffee orchards on behalf of the land owners. This segment also cultivates, harvests, and sells bananas, citrus fruits, and alfalfa, as well as engages in ranching operations. The company sells milled green coffee under the Mauigrown Coffee brand. Its Property segment primarily develops land for sale, as well as negotiates the bulk sale of undeveloped land. The company was incorporated in 2002 and is based in Chicago, Illinois. Kaanapali Land, LLC is a subsidiary of Pacific Trail Holdings, LLC.
